Considering building a rifle off of a CZ 550 long magnum action. My question concerns tenon diameter, length and whether the threads are metric or English.
 
We were just discussing CZ barrel threads on another thread here. “500 Jeffrey action options” is the thread title. Hope it helps.
 
I haven't measured one, but from what I've read it's a metric M28x2 thread. Note: The standard length action will have a smaller thread.
 
And the std 550 is M26x2.
I am sure I have dimensioned sketches for both but where?
However, better measure your action or take-off barrel, there might be variants.
